God’s promises are more reliable than any human’s. He does not lie. He cannot lie. That means when He promises to forgive, to rescue, to give eternal life — He means it. And He will do it.
Having assurance means living in peace and confidence. We don’t have to wonder if we’re good enough. We don’t have to be afraid of death. We can live with joy, knowing our future is secure.
Peter wrote to Christians who were discouraged and unsure — just like people today. That’s why he reminded them of the living hope they had through Jesus. And it’s why we remind each other today.
